Hip roof shingle repair services focus on maintaining the integrity and appearance of homes with hip-style roof structures, which feature slopes on all four sides that meet at the top. These repairs typically include fixing damaged or missing shingles, addressing leaks, and replacing worn or deteriorated materials to prevent further damage. Projects can range from minor patchwork to more extensive repairs after severe weather events, ensuring the roof remains weather-tight and structurally sound.
Homeowners often seek hip roof shingle repair services to address issues such as shingle cracking, curling, or missing shingles that compromise the roof’s protection. Before requesting repairs, property owners should consider the extent of damage, the age of the roofing materials, and whether there are signs of leaks or water intrusion. Understanding these factors can help determine the appropriate scope of work needed to restore the roof’s functionality and curb appeal.

Hip Roof Shingle Repair Questions
What types of damage can affect a hip roof with shingles? Common issues include missing shingles, curling edges, and leaks caused by weather or aging materials.
How can I tell if my hip roof needs shingle repairs? Signs include visible damage, water stains on ceilings, or shingles that are cracked or missing.
What are typical repairs for a damaged hip roof? Repairs often involve replacing broken or missing shingles, sealing leaks, and reinforcing damaged areas.
Is it better to repair or replace shingles on a hip roof? Repairs are suitable for localized damage, while replacement may be necessary for extensive wear or multiple damaged shingles.
